Typified by an overstorey dominated by multi- stemmed acacia shrubs. Occur mainly in temperate semi-arid and arid regions of Australia, although they also extend into the tropical arid regions of north-west Queensland and eastern Northern Territory. Occur mainly on extensive undulating plains and downs, low hills and valleys ...

Shrubland, scrubland, and scrub or the brush, also known as the bush come under plant community. They are characterized by vegetation that is dominated by shrub plants and often they include grass type, herbs, and geophytes.
